I am new to Qlik Sense and want to create a new field which displays values based on the different conditions in two existing fields [Status] & [State].
Field 1: [Status] | Field 2: [State] | New field: [Display] |
Draft | Not Executed | Draft |
Ready for Approval | Not Executed | Draft |
Approved | Not Executed | Draft |
Approved | Executed | Approved |
Varied | Executed | Varied |
Ready for Approval | Executed | Varied |
Inactive | Executed | Inactive |
Inactive | Not Executed | Inactive |
Varied | Not Executed | Draft |
I have been trying to build this with If statements but have not been successful - appreciate some assistance.
Why don't you use a mapping table to do this
MappingTable:
Mapping
LOAD Status&State,
Display
FROM ....;
FactTable:
LOAD ....,
ApplyMap('MappingTable', Status&State, 'N/A') as NewField,
....
FROM ....
